C15H16ClN3O5S — CID 21314184
(4-nitrophenyl)methyl 7-amino-3-chloro-3-methyl-8-oxo-5-thia-1-azabicyclo[4.2.0]octane-2-carboxylate (PubChem CID 21314184) has the molecular formula C15H16ClN3O5S and a molecular weight of 385.83 g/mol. Its IUPAC name is (4-nitrophenyl)methyl 7-amino-3-chloro-3-methyl-8-oxo-5-thia-1-azabicyclo[4.2.0]octane-2-carboxylate.
